Bike Dimension and Fit



When choosing a bicycle for your youngster, the significance of bike size and fit can not be overstated. A properly sized bike boosts security and comfort, allowing your child to create their riding abilities successfully. A bike that is too huge might lead to instability, while one that is also small can hinder growth and restrict activity.


The majority of makers provide sizing charts that correlate these measurements with wheel dimensions, normally ranging from 12 inches for young children to 24 inches for older youngsters. When your youngster sits on the saddle, they should be able to touch the ground with their toes, ensuring they can stop securely.

Weight Considerations



Weight considerations play an important function in picking the right bike for your child. Generally, a bike must weigh no more than 30% of the kid's body weight.


When evaluating bike weight, materials are substantial. Light weight aluminum frames are typically favored over steel because of their lighter weight and similar longevity. Additionally, the elements of the bike, consisting of wheels, brakes, and equipments, can add to the overall weight. Selecting a bike with simpler, top notch components can minimize weight while preserving efficiency.


One more critical element is the bike's meant use. If the child will certainly be riding on varied terrain or taking part in off-road activities, a somewhat larger bike might offer security. For general usage and informal riding, focusing on a lightweight choice will boost the overall experience.


Safety And Security Features



Various security features are vital to consider when choosing a bicycle for your kid, as they substantially improve defense during rides. Make sure that the bike is equipped with dependable brakes. Both hand brakes and rollercoaster brakes should be receptive and easy for youngsters to use, enabling reliable stopping power.

Furthermore, the presence of lights and reflectors is essential for visibility, especially if your child will certainly be riding in low-light conditions. Look for bikes that include reflectors on the front, back, and wheels, as well as an incorporated headlight and taillight where feasible.


Another important function is a chain guard, which protects against apparel or limbs from getting captured in the chain, lowering the risk of injury. Moreover, bikes with safety holds and cushioned handlebars can supply additional protection ought to your child fall.
